Delta offers business class under the name Delta One. This service includes lie-flat seats, providing excellent comfort on international flights. Unlike regional first-class seats on U.S. carriers, which use oversized recliners, Delta One focuses on an upgraded travel experience with premium amenities and attentive service.
Delta’s cabin class structure includes several other options, such as First Class and Main Cabin. First Class offers wider seats and complimentary snacks and beverages. However, it lacks the full suite of amenities found in Delta One. The Main Cabin serves the standard economy experience, with basic seating and in-flight services.
The differences between Delta One, First Class, and Main Cabin cater to various passenger needs and preferences. Delta One stands out for long-haul international flights, while First Class and Main Cabin address shorter trips and budget-conscious travelers.

How Is Delta’s Cabin Class Structure Organized?
Delta’s cabin class structure is organized into several distinct categories. The primary classes include Delta One, First Class, Delta Premium Select, and Main Cabin. Delta One serves as the airline’s premium international class. It features lie-flat seats and superior service. First Class is available on some domestic flights. It offers extra legroom, larger seats, and enhanced service. Delta Premium Select is an upgraded option that provides more space and amenities than Main Cabin. It is designed for international travel. Main Cabin represents the standard economy experience. It includes basic seating and in-flight services. This organization allows Delta to cater to different passenger needs and preferences.
What Distinctions Exist Between Delta’s Main Cabin and Delta One?
The distinctions between Delta’s Main Cabin and Delta One are significant in terms of seating, services, and overall amenities.
- Seating Configuration
- In-Flight Service
- Food and Beverage Options
- Airport Lounge Access
- Baggage Allowance
- Price Difference
Considering these differences, it is important to examine each category in detail.
-
Seating Configuration: Delta One features lie-flat seats in a 1-2-1 arrangement for direct aisle access. The Main Cabin has standard economy seating, typically arranged in a 3-3 configuration, limiting space and comfort.
-
In-Flight Service: Delta One provides personalized service from dedicated flight attendants. Main Cabin service is standard and not as personalized, focusing on efficiency rather than individual attention.
-
Food and Beverage Options: Delta One offers a multi-course meal service with premium dining options, including wine pairings. In contrast, the Main Cabin meals consist of simpler choices with limited selection, often served in standard trays.
-
Airport Lounge Access: Passengers flying Delta One receive access to Delta Sky Club lounges before their flights. This perk enhances comfort with complimentary refreshments and a quieter environment. Main Cabin passengers do not have this access unless they hold a separate membership.
-
Baggage Allowance: Delta One travelers can check multiple bags at no extra cost, while Main Cabin passengers typically have a more limited allowance, which may incur additional fees.
-
Price Difference: Delta One tickets are priced significantly higher than Main Cabin tickets, reflecting the enhanced experience and amenities.
These distinctions highlight the range of options available to travelers and help users choose between comfort and budget for their flight experience.
